Learning Objectives

5 objectives
  • Understand the historical development and fundamental concepts of carpentry and joinery.
  • Identify and evaluate different types of wood and their suitability for various projects.
  • Demonstrate knowledge of traditional and modern joinery techniques and their applications.
  • Gain proficiency in the use of essential carpentry tools and equipment.
  • Apply sustainable and safe practices in carpentry projects.

Unit 3708: Comprehensive Carpentry and Joinery

1. Introduction to Carpentry and Joinery

  • Overview of history and evolution
  • Importance in construction and furniture making
  • Basic concepts: definitions, scope, and terminology
  • Introduction to tools, materials, and techniques

2. Types of Wood and Their Characteristics

  • Classification of wood types
    • Softwoods: examples, properties, and typical uses
    • Hardwoods: examples, properties, and typical uses
    • Engineered woods: plywood, MDF, particleboard
  • Characteristics of wood: grain, density, moisture content
  • Strengths and weaknesses of each wood type
  • Selection criteria for different projects

3. Joinery Techniques

  • Traditional joinery methods
    • Mortise and tenon joints: structure and applications
    • Dovetail joints: types and uses
  • Modern joinery methods
    • Biscuit joints: advantages and limitations
    • Pocket hole joinery: tools and techniques
  • Purpose and application of each joinery technique
  • Practical considerations for joint strength and aesthetics

4. Carpentry Tools and Equipment

  • Hand tools
    • Saws: types (handsaw, backsaw, coping saw)
    • Chisels: types and sharpening
    • Planes: smoothing, block, and jack planes
  • Power tools
    • Drills and drivers
    • Routers: uses and safety
    • Sanders: belt, orbital, and detail sanders
  • Tool maintenance and safety protocols

5. Case Study: Building a Wooden Bookshelf

  • Project planning and design considerations
  • Material selection based on project needs
  • Application of joinery techniques
  • Step-by-step construction process
  • Finishing and surface treatment used
  • Challenges and troubleshooting

6. Finishing and Surface Treatment

  • Surface preparation: sanding, cleaning
  • Finishing techniques
    • Staining: types and application
    • Painting: primers and paints
    • Varnishing: types and protective qualities
    • Oiling: natural finishes
  • Importance of finishing for durability and aesthetics

7. Sustainable Practices in Carpentry and Joinery

  • Use of reclaimed and recycled wood
  • Eco-friendly finishes and adhesives
  • Energy-efficient tools and machinery
  • Responsible sourcing: certification and standards
  • Waste reduction and recycling techniques

8. Case Study: Repairing a Wooden Door

  • Damage assessment and diagnosis
  • Selecting appropriate repair methods
  • Step-by-step repair process
  • Restoring structural integrity and appearance
  • Preventative maintenance tips

9. Advanced Joinery Techniques

  • Half-blind dovetails: construction and uses
  • Through-tenons: design and strength considerations
  • Sliding dovetails: applications and challenges
  • Required precision and skill development
  • Tools and jigs to assist advanced joinery

10. Career Paths in Carpentry and Joinery

  • Furniture making and cabinetry
  • Restoration and conservation work
  • Architectural woodworking
  • Skills and training pathways
  • Certifications and professional development
  • Industry outlook and emerging trends
